3 Star 6 Fork 0

Gitee 极速下载/linen

加入 Gitee
与超过 1200万 开发者一起发现、参与优秀开源项目,私有仓库也完全免费 :)
免费加入
文件
此仓库是为了提升国内下载速度的镜像仓库,每日同步一次。 原始仓库: https://github.com/linen-dev/linen.dev
克隆/下载
Dockerfile 837 Bytes
一键复制 编辑 原始数据 按行查看 历史
Sandro de Souza 提交于 2023-07-31 23:44 +08:00 . Extract queue to separate package #1438
FROM public.ecr.aws/docker/library/node:18 AS builder
RUN apt-get update && apt-get install -y openssl
WORKDIR /app
RUN yarn global add turbo
COPY . .
RUN turbo prune --scope="@linen/queue" --docker
FROM public.ecr.aws/docker/library/node:18 AS installer
RUN apt-get update && apt-get install -y openssl
WORKDIR /app
COPY .gitignore .gitignore
COPY --from=builder /app/out/json/ .
COPY --from=builder /app/out/yarn.lock ./yarn.lock
RUN yarn install
COPY --from=builder /app/out/full/ .
COPY turbo.json turbo.json
RUN yarn turbo run build --filter='@linen/queue'
FROM public.ecr.aws/docker/library/node:18 AS runner
RUN apt-get update && apt-get install -y openssl
WORKDIR /app
RUN yarn global add pm2
# RUN addgroup --system --gid 1001 linenuser
# RUN adduser --system --uid 1001 linenuser
# USER linenuser
COPY --from=installer /app .
Loading...
马建仓 AI 助手
尝试更多
代码解读
代码找茬
代码优化
JavaScript
1
https://gitee.com/mirrors/linen.git
git@gitee.com:mirrors/linen.git
mirrors
linen
linen
main

搜索帮助